Rick Hall owns a card shop, Hall's Cards. The following cash information is available for the month of August, Year 3.
As of August 31, the bank statement shows a balance of $13,050. The August 31 unadjusted balance in the Cash account of Hall's
Cards is $10,011. A review of the bank statement revealed the following information:
A deposit of $1,870 on August 31, Year 3, does not appear on the August bank statement.
It was discovered that a check to pay for baseball cards was correctly written and paid by the bank for $2,135 but was recorded on
the books as $3,035.
When checks written during the month were compared with those paid by the bank, three checks amounting to $4,100 were found
to be outstanding.
A debit memo for $91 was included in the bank statement for the purchase of a new supply of checks.
Required:
Prepare a bank reconciliation at the end of August showing the true cash balance.
Note: Negative amounts should be indicated with minus sign.
